bearbasketThe first time I saw a stuffed shark peeking above an open can’s rim, I knew that plush animals would become part of my gift basket designs.

The shark was displayed at a trade show and was perfect for a corporate gift created for an attorney. Its appearance showed that it had bit through the can which was wrapped with a label stating “Canned Shark.”

I immediately wrote an order for canned sharks, bears, moose and other assorted animals.

Most of these plush pets sold well, and I was lucky because I didn’t determine ahead of time which animals would be paired with specific designs (this is a project I encourage you to complete before buying any product).

One reason why plush is a great staple is that it doesn’t expire. Other reasons include the ease of placing them in baby baskets, Valentine’s Day themes, and men’s baskets. That covers a lot of ground and ensures turnover and profitability.
